As per section 61 – Scrutiny of returns read with rule 99, Officer may scrutinize the return furnished by the registered person to verify the correctness of the return and inform him of the discrepancies noticed (Form GST ASMT-10) and seek his explanation thereto.

Corporate Social Responsibility is a management concept whereby companies integrate social and environmental concerns in their business operations and interactions with their stakeholders and the public. Benefits The benefits of CSR are many. Companies establish good reputations, attract positive attention, save money through operational efficiency, minimize environmental impacts, attract top talent and inspire innovation.
